概括
水在半孔中部分结晶会改变其动态,影响温度依赖性和易受性. 接口层中的水表现出跳跃运动,而不是有争议的交叉.

背景情况:
- 封闭式水表现出复杂的动态,包括动态交叉.
- 局限系统中的部分结晶引入了新的动态模式.
研究的目的:
- 在部分结晶过程中调查中性二氧化中的水动力学.
- 描述毛孔大小和界面对水和冰动态的影响.
主要方法:
- 宽带介电光谱学 (BDS). 宽带介电光谱学.
- 核磁共振 (NMR) 场循环放松计和刺激回声实验.
- 分子动力学模拟 (MDS).分子动力学模拟.
主要成果:
- 部分结晶改变了旋转关联时间的温度依赖性,受孔径的影响.
- 动态易感性从液态水中的不对称转变为更广泛的,在部分结状态下对称.
- 不结的界面水动力学是由静态能量景观控制的,具有高斯式的屏障分布,显示跳跃运动.
结论:
- 封闭水的动态被部分结晶和孔隙封闭显著改变.
- 界面水动力学与散水不同,由表面相互作用来解释.
- 封闭式冰相遵循阿雷尼乌斯动态,可结水的激活能量在不同的封闭中保持一致.

Typical Model Studies
354
Fluid mechanics model studies often utilize scaled-down systems to predict fluid behavior in full-scale environments, such as river flows, dam spillways, and structures interacting with open surfaces. Maintaining Froude number similarity in river models is crucial, as it replicates surface flow features like wave patterns and velocities.

Design Example: Creating a Hydraulic Model of a Dam Spillway
158
Scaled hydraulic models of dam spillways provide a practical way to replicate and study the intricate flow dynamics of these structures. Often built to a 1:15 ratio, these models allow for observing critical water behavior, such as velocity distribution, flow patterns, and energy dissipation.

Entropy and Solvation
7.0K
The process of surrounding a solute with solvent is called solvation. It involves evenly distributing the solute within the solvent. The rule of thumb for determining a solvent for a given compound is that like dissolves like. A good solvent has molecular characteristics similar to those of the compound to be dissolved. Rapidly Varying Flow
57
Rapidly varying flow (RVF) in open channels is characterized by abrupt changes in flow depth over a short distance, with the rate of depth change relative to distance often approaching unity. These flows are inherently complex due to their transient and multi-dimensional nature, making exact analysis difficult.
